There are 3 main ways to move from Billings to Cleveland: full-service movers, moving containers, and rental trucks. Full-service is the most expensive but covers everything from labor to transportation, with a 2-3 bedroom move on this route averaging $3,694 - $7,991. Containers cost roughly 30% less than full-service for the same home size, and rental trucks run about 60% less, though loading is on you with either DIY option. At 1,578 miles, expect 4 to 15 days in transit no matter which service you choose.
Here is how full-service movers, moving containers, rental trucks, and freight trailers compare on the 1,578-mile route from Billings to Cleveland, broken down by home size:
- A studio or 1-bedroom move runs $2,798 - $6,176 with full-service movers, $1,405 - $2,723 with a container, $942 - $1,923 with a rental truck, or $1,397 - $2,501 by freight.
- A 2 - 3 bedroom home costs $3,694 - $7,991 full-service, $1,967 - $3,962 by container, $1,106 - $2,242 by rental truck, or $1,604 - $2,952 by freight.
- A larger 4+ bedroom household runs $6,748 - $12,451 full-service, $2,732 - $4,937 by container, $1,353 - $2,796 by rental truck, or $2,144 - $4,074 by freight.

Full-service moving costs from Billings, MT to Cleveland, OH
Full-service movers for the 1,578-mile relocation from Billings, Montana, to Cleveland, Ohio, cost between $2,798 and $12,451. With a long-distance moving company, loading, transportation, and unloading are all taken care of. If you want to skip packing boxes, too, that can be added for $271 - $1,804, depending on your home size. What you pay in the end is mainly a function of how much your shipment weighs and how far it's traveling. As a point of reference, local movers in Billings typically charge a base rate around $259 plus $105 per hour, per mover.

Good to know: For moves over 500 miles, national movers are consistently lower-priced than local companies in Billings, MT. Van lines spread long-haul costs across multiple shipments, while local movers tend to charge 30% - 40% more for the same distance. A direct route with a local mover averages 2-day delivery, but that added speed typically carries a higher price tag.

What other costs come with moving containers?
- Storage: Monthly rental charges begin after the first 30 days. Expect roughly $68 per month for smaller containers (7 - 8 feet) and around $135 per month for larger units (12 - 16 feet).
- Moving labor: Containers don't come with loading help, so many customers hire hourly movers for the job. Two movers for about 5 hours will run you around $631 in Billings, MT, per moveBuddha data. Compare the best labor-only movers nationwide
- Added contents protection: Standard coverage only reimburses by weight. Full-value protection gives you more complete coverage for higher-value items and typically costs 1% - 2% of your total declared value, around $500 - $1,000 on a $50,000 shipment.
- Access: National providers generally operate in both cities, but verify that a facility near your Cleveland, OH, destination exists if you plan to access stored items.
Pro tip: Before ordering moving containers, take a careful inventory of everything you're moving. A typical 1-bedroom home weighs around 3,000 pounds and fits in a single container starting at $1,405. Underestimating and needing 1 - 2 additional containers can push your total to $1,967 - $3,962, so getting your count right upfront saves you from a costly surprise.

What other costs come with rental trucks?
- Moving labor: Rental trucks don't come with loaders. Hiring 2 movers in Billings, Montana, for roughly 5 hours usually costs about $631.
- Gas: Fuel costs total $453 - $518 for the 1,578-mile drive, depending on whether your truck takes gas or diesel.
- Equipment: Appliance dollies, auto transport trailers, and furniture pads are separate rentals. Expect to spend between $54 and $293, depending on what you need.
- Additional insurance: Daily coverage upgrades typically add around $30.
- Lodging: Budget around $135 per night for hotel stops on the 1,578-mile drive. With 2 - 3 overnight stops, total lodging typically costs $271 - $406.

Freight trailer costs from Billings, MT to Cleveland, OH
Freight trailers are well suited for larger moves from Billings, Montana, to Cleveland, Ohio, when you want to do the loading yourself without having to drive a massive vehicle. The trailer is delivered, you pack it up, and the carrier handles the long haul.
What sets freight trailers apart is the pay-for-what-you-use pricing model. Each additional foot of trailer space you occupy adds to the cost. Overall pricing for a move of this size and distance typically lands around $1,604 and $2,952.
Take a look at freight trailer costs based on home size for moves from Billings to Cleveland:
-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,397 - $2,501
- 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,604 - $2,952
- 4+ bedrooms: $2,144 - $4,074
Pro tip: Loading a freight trailer is a bit different from filling a container. The 4-foot ramp can be steep with large items, and getting the most out of 8 feet of vertical clearance takes planning. Since pricing is based on linear feet used, every inch of wasted space has a cost.
What other costs come with freight trailers?
- Demand cycles: Trailer costs climb during peak moving season, especially from mid-May through mid-September when demand is at its highest.
- More space: You're billed only for the linear feet you use, but underestimating your inventory means paying for extra space, typically around $68 - $135 more per foot.
- Moving labor: Freight trailers don't include loading crews. Two movers in Billings, Montana, for about five hours typically runs $631.

Pro tip: One of the biggest advantages of freight trailers is speed. For an interstate move, freight delivery is one of the fastest options you have short of driving a rental truck yourself. It's a smart choice when your timeline is firm and you'll be ready to receive your shipment. If there's any chance your new place won't be ready or you need a few weeks of storage, a moving container with built-in storage may serve you better.

How do I know a mover is licensed in Ohio?
Although a local license is not required in Ohio, make sure the moving company you’ll be hiring is registered with U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T). To verify if you’re dealing with a legal and licensed mover, you may ask them their USDOT registration number.
